#dd804e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d804e is composed of 86.7% red, 50.2%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 64.7%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 21 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#dd804e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#bb0100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#dd804e color description : Soft orange.
#dd804e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d804e has RGB values of R:221, G:128,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.65,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14516302.

Shades and Tints of #dd804e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d804e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c948f is the less saturated color, while #fd762e is the most saturated one.
